Compatibility of Curt Class I Hitch on 2010 Nissan Versa with Mobility Scooter Carrier
Question:
I have a 2010 Nissan Versa . I want to put on a Curt receiver hitch Class 1 to accommodate a scooter lift. The scooter lift a a Harmar AL160 Profile Scooter lift. Will this hitch be able to bare the weight of the scooter lift? thank you.
asked by: Mary G
Expert Reply:
A Class I hitch, including the Curt # C11348 that would fit on your 2010 Nissan Versa has a relatively low tongue weight capacity of 200 lbs. The tongue weight capacity represents the maximum amount of weight that can be safely hung from the hitch.
This means that your Harmar AL 160 Profile Scooter Lift plus the weight of the scooter itself could weigh no more than 200 lbs. Exceeding that weight limit could cause the hitch to bend or the hitch attachments to the vehicle to fail, which would be bad.
Your best bet would either be a different vehicle that can use a Class III hitch with a higher weight capacity, or to use a small trailer like # K2MMT5X7.
